173/* parse_die - parse a Dwarf1 die.
174   Parse the die starting at 'aDiePtr' into 'aDieInfo'.
175   'abfd' must be the bfd from which the section that 'aDiePtr'
176   points to was pulled from.
177
178   Return FALSE if the die is invalidly formatted; TRUE otherwise.  */
179
180static bool
181parse_die (bfd *	     abfd,
182	   struct die_info * aDieInfo,
183	   bfd_byte *	     aDiePtr,
184	   bfd_byte *	     aDiePtrEnd)
185{
186  bfd_byte *this_die = aDiePtr;
187  bfd_byte *xptr = this_die;
188
189  memset (aDieInfo, 0, sizeof (* aDieInfo));
190
191  /* First comes the length.  */
192  if (xptr + 4 > aDiePtrEnd)
193    return false;
194  aDieInfo->length = bfd_get_32 (abfd, xptr);
195  xptr += 4;
196  if (aDieInfo->length <= 4
197      || (size_t) (aDiePtrEnd - this_die) < aDieInfo->length)
198    return false;
199  aDiePtrEnd = this_die + aDieInfo->length;
200  if (aDieInfo->length < 6)
201    {
202      /* Just padding bytes.  */
203      aDieInfo->tag = TAG_padding;
204      return true;
205    }
206
207  /* Then the tag.  */
208  if (xptr + 2 > aDiePtrEnd)
209    return false;
210  aDieInfo->tag = bfd_get_16 (abfd, xptr);
211  xptr += 2;
212
213  /* Then the attributes.  */
214  while (xptr + 2 <= aDiePtrEnd)
215    {
216      unsigned int   block_len;
217      unsigned short attr;
218
219      /* Parse the attribute based on its form.  This section
220	 must handle all dwarf1 forms, but need only handle the
221	 actual attributes that we care about.  */
222      attr = bfd_get_16 (abfd, xptr);
223      xptr += 2;
224
225      switch (FORM_FROM_ATTR (attr))
226	{
227	case FORM_DATA2:
228	  xptr += 2;
229	  break;
230	case FORM_DATA4:
231	case FORM_REF:
232	  if (xptr + 4 <= aDiePtrEnd)
233	    {
234	      if (attr == AT_sibling)
235		aDieInfo->sibling = bfd_get_32 (abfd, xptr);
236	      else if (attr == AT_stmt_list)
237		{
238		  aDieInfo->stmt_list_offset = bfd_get_32 (abfd, xptr);
239		  aDieInfo->has_stmt_list = 1;
240		}
241	    }
242	  xptr += 4;
243	  break;
244	case FORM_DATA8:
245	  xptr += 8;
246	  break;
247	case FORM_ADDR:
248	  if (xptr + 4 <= aDiePtrEnd)
249	    {
250	      if (attr == AT_low_pc)
251		aDieInfo->low_pc = bfd_get_32 (abfd, xptr);
252	      else if (attr == AT_high_pc)
253		aDieInfo->high_pc = bfd_get_32 (abfd, xptr);
254	    }
255	  xptr += 4;
256	  break;
257	case FORM_BLOCK2:
258	  if (xptr + 2 <= aDiePtrEnd)
259	    {
260	      block_len = bfd_get_16 (abfd, xptr);
261	      if ((size_t) (aDiePtrEnd - xptr) < block_len)
262		return false;
263	      xptr += block_len;
264	    }
265	  xptr += 2;
266	  break;
267	case FORM_BLOCK4:
268	  if (xptr + 4 <= aDiePtrEnd)
269	    {
270	      block_len = bfd_get_32 (abfd, xptr);
271	      if ((size_t) (aDiePtrEnd - xptr) < block_len)
272		return false;
273	      xptr += block_len;
274	    }
275	  xptr += 4;
276	  break;
277	case FORM_STRING:
278	  if (attr == AT_name)
279	    aDieInfo->name = (char *) xptr;
280	  xptr += strnlen ((char *) xptr, aDiePtrEnd - xptr) + 1;
281	  break;
282	}
283    }
284
285  return true;
286}

288/* Parse a dwarf1 line number table for 'aUnit->stmt_list_offset'
289   into 'aUnit->linenumber_table'.  Return FALSE if an error
290   occurs; TRUE otherwise.  */
291
292static bool
293parse_line_table (struct dwarf1_debug* stash, struct dwarf1_unit* aUnit)
294{
295  bfd_byte *xptr;
296
297  /* Load the ".line" section from the bfd if we haven't already.  */
298  if (stash->line_section == 0)
299    {
300      asection *msec;
301      bfd_size_type size;
302
303      msec = bfd_get_section_by_name (stash->abfd, ".line");
304      if (! msec)
305	return false;
306
307      size = msec->rawsize ? msec->rawsize : msec->size;
308      stash->line_section
309	= bfd_simple_get_relocated_section_contents
310	(stash->abfd, msec, NULL, stash->syms);
311
312      if (! stash->line_section)
313	return false;
314
315      stash->line_section_end = stash->line_section + size;
316    }
317
318  xptr = stash->line_section + aUnit->stmt_list_offset;
319  if (xptr + 8 <= stash->line_section_end)
320    {
321      unsigned long eachLine;
322      bfd_byte *tblend;
323      unsigned long base;
324      bfd_size_type amt;
325
326      /* First comes the length.  */
327      tblend = bfd_get_32 (stash->abfd, (bfd_byte *) xptr) + xptr;
328      xptr += 4;
329
330      /* Then the base address for each address in the table.  */
331      base = bfd_get_32 (stash->abfd, (bfd_byte *) xptr);
332      xptr += 4;
333
334      /* How many line entrys?
335	 10 = 4 (line number) + 2 (pos in line) + 4 (address in line).  */
336      aUnit->line_count = (tblend - xptr) / 10;
337
338      /* Allocate an array for the entries.  */
339      amt = sizeof (struct linenumber) * aUnit->line_count;
340      aUnit->linenumber_table = (struct linenumber *) bfd_alloc (stash->abfd,
341								 amt);
342      if (!aUnit->linenumber_table)
343	return false;
344
345      for (eachLine = 0; eachLine < aUnit->line_count; eachLine++)
346	{
347	  if (xptr + 10 > stash->line_section_end)
348	    {
349	      aUnit->line_count = eachLine;
350	      break;
351	    }
352	  /* A line number.  */
353	  aUnit->linenumber_table[eachLine].linenumber
354	    = bfd_get_32 (stash->abfd, (bfd_byte *) xptr);
355	  xptr += 4;
356
357	  /* Skip the position within the line.  */
358	  xptr += 2;
359
360	  /* And finally the address.  */
361	  aUnit->linenumber_table[eachLine].addr
362	    = base + bfd_get_32 (stash->abfd, (bfd_byte *) xptr);
363	  xptr += 4;
364	}
365    }
366
367  return true;
368}
